Canyon and Corona squ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but Canyon had to settle for second. They fell just short of the Corona Panthers by a score of 3-2. The Cowboys' defeat signaled the end of their six-game winning streak.
Canyon took a 2-1 lead headed into the fourth set, but sadly they lost the next two. The match finished with set scores of 25-20, 19-25, 22-25, 25-22, 15-9.
Canyon's loss dropped their record down to 22-14. As for Corona, the victory (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 24-14.
Both are set to take part in some playoff action in their next matches. Canyon will face off against El Capitan at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Corona, they will square off against Valencia at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
